#P10902. [蓝桥杯 2024 省 C] 回文数组
[蓝桥杯 2024 省 C] 回文数组
题目描述
小蓝在无聊时随机生成了一个长度为 的整数数组,数组中的第 个数为 ,他觉得随机生成的数组不太美观,想把它变成回文数组,也是就对于任意 满足 。小蓝一次操作可以指定相邻的两个数,将它们一起加 或减 ;也可以只指定一个数加 或减 ,请问他最少需要操作多少次能把这个数组变成回文数组?
输入格式
输入的第一行包含一个正整数 。
第二行包含 个整数 ,相邻整数之间使用一个空格分隔。
输出格式
输出一行包含一个整数表示答案。
4
1 2 3 4
3
提示
【样例说明】
第一次操作将 加 ,变为 ;
后面两次操作将 加 ,变为 。
【评测用例规模与约定】
对于 的评测用例,;
对于所有评测用例,,。